Remove and Re-Add

Windows 10

  1. Select the Network icon in the lower-right corner of your screen

  2. Select Network settings

  3. Select Manage Wi-Fi settings

  4. Select the network you want to forget from the list under “Manage known networks”

  5. Select Forget.

iOS

  1. Go to Settings > Wi-Fi

  2. Select the network you wish to forget by tapping the icon of the “i” within the circle

  3. Select Forget This Network.

Android

To delete a saved Wifi network from your phone or tablet, all you need to do is go to the Wifi section of your settings menu. Find the network you want to get rid of. Long press it, then chose "Forget."

Chromebook

  1. Sign in to your Chromebook.

  2. At the bottom right, select the time.

  3. Select Settings .

  4. In the "Network" section, select Wi-Fi.

  5. Select Known networks.

  6. Find the network you want to forget, then select More and then Forget.

Expired Password

Your North Park password must meet the following requirements.

Minimum 14 characters

Use 3 or 4 of the following:

  • Uppercase letter

  • Lowercase letter

  • Number

  • Special character

If you know your password but want to change it, log into the My Profile page and choose Change Password:

https://myprofile.microsoft.com 

If you do not know your password, or are setting up your account for the first time, use Microsoft’s Self-Service Password Reset.

You will need to have access to your secondary authentication factors.

https://passwordreset.microsoftonline.com/
